Daily use centers on stepping, balancing, and jumping between stones, with children naturally progressing toward more complex sequences as confidence grows. Supervision is recommended for younger toddlers during longer play periods or when introducing new layouts.
For best results, place stones on flat, clean surfaces and consider a soft indoor surface to reduce impact on hard floors. On outdoor ground, ensure the area provides adequate grip and footing. When evaluating balance stone sets, consider grip quality, surface texture, color variety, and how easily the set can be reconfigured. Compared with foam stepping stones, these plastic stones offer firmer footing and greater durability; compared with wooden options, they are typically lighter and simpler to rearrange for quick circuit changes.
How to choose: Look for a non-slip underside, a textured top surface, and a safe, rounded design. Which type is better depends on the intended environment—indoor spaces may benefit from soft surfaces, while outdoor use requires weather-resistant materials. What to look for includes easy cleaning, a convenient storage solution, and a diverse color set. Common mistakes to avoid involve placing stones on uneven surfaces, using layouts that exceed a child’s current skill level, or failing to supervise during active play.
How to choose the right balance stones for toddlers: Prioritize stability, simple connections between pieces, and gradual progression to more complex paths to sustain engagement without overwhelming the child.
Which type is better for indoor vs outdoor use: Consider surface durability, slip resistance after weather exposure, and how easily the set folds or nests for storage in limited spaces.
Maintenance is minimal: wipe down after use with a damp cloth and mild soap if needed, then air-dry before storage. Regularly inspect connections and edges for any signs of wear to ensure ongoing safety during play.
Storage is streamlined with the included bag, allowing quick containment and transport for trips to relatives’ homes or vacations. To preserve color and material integrity, avoid prolonged exposure to sharp heat sources or direct, intense sun for extended periods.
